ost Indian states and UTs are in denial mode about the existence of bonded labour. Law Enforcers have mostly not lived up to the laudable intentions of the frameworks of the bonded labour (abolition) Act, 1976. Governments failed to translate into action the directions of the Supreme Court and recommendations of the National human rights Commission. This book seeks to change the mind-set of those tasked with removing modern-day bondage. It seeks to promote a broad awareness and critical consciousness about the provisions of the Constitution in the minds of all stakeholders, especially Non-profits. This has been done through a dialectical exercise or Q&A format.
